Use uname -S to name or rename a node. • HP-UX patches To use the plug-in, the PHCO_36309 patch must be installed. The plug-in support is listed in "Plug-in description" (page 5) (HP-UX nodes not listed are ignored). • Monitored LUN OS device permission The plug-in will not be able to monitor storage devices on operating systems if the any device special files are not given the correct Oracle ownership and permission. For example, # chown oracle:oinstall /dev/rdisk/r* Oracle Enterprise Manager configuration prerequisites The plug-in supports Oracle Enterprise Manager 10.2.0.3 or later and 11.1.0.1 or later. See "Plug-in components" (page 5) for more information. NOTE: All databases that are monitored by the plug-in must have the preferred credentials for host, agent, and database targets. For details on setting preferred credentials, refer to the Oracle Enterprise Manager documentation. Oracle Enterprise Manager configuration prerequisites 7
